I’ve spent the whole day trying to install HA OS on an x86 Lenovo M72e Tiny PC. Whatever I try, I just get a no boot os found error. I can boot from a USB install just fine, but if I install to the SSD I consistently get this error.
It seems from this post English Community-Lenovo Community that the PC won’t boot without seeing ‘Windows Boot Manager’ in the boot manager list. Is there a way I (a noob) can edit this to add it in?

In your case it looks like the UEFI system is either not enabled or not available.
HA requires UEFI BIOS with SecureBoot disabled.
